"Strike Up the Band"
Hoshi almost laughed as Enterprise headed toward the Expanse. The whole departure felt oddly anticlimactic, as if someone should march beside them playing drum and fife, trumpeting the songs of war.
Because Enterprise--Earth's first warp five ship, built for peaceful exploration--was off to war.
She was there because of loyalty, others had stayed for revenge. Earth had never known such a devastating attack and floundered in its wake, but Starfleet knew what to do.
In her mind, the band played as Enterprise went to warp.
She couldn't tell if it was a victory march or a funeral dirge.
